Hey Darcy,
Before Freckles' dental I posted for advice to this forum and read the dental sticky. I was offered some "do's and don'ts" and some "maybe's". It allowed me to have the supplies on hand in case Freckles had diarrhea or heaven forbid - didn't want to eat. Plus I posted what my vet wanted to do regarding insulin amounts, eating schedule, antibiotics, probiotics etc. Plus I received tips on making her stay at the vets less stressful. I found I was much more prepared and confident in how the day would go.

I also made a paper collar for Freckles and wrote DIABETIC on it... I didn't want any "Oops, we forgot to check her" scenarios. :rolleyes:
